02/12/24 (Agence Europe) – The new regulation on the Single European Sky (SES2+) came into force on Sunday 1 December, and should contribute to a more efficient and sustainable European airspace (see EUROPE 13509/13). It aims to encourage air navigation service providers to achieve efficiency gains and adopt modern technologies in order to reduce congestion in European airspace and provide better quality services. It also aims to promote innovation and the development of new services in the sector. This new regulation should reduce the environmental impact of flights by setting climate and environmental performance targets for air navigation service providers and encouraging airlines to adopt more sustainable practices through a fair pricing system.
